One of the most distinct features of this new era is what critics might call the "Coffee Shop Aesthetic"—films like Filosofi Kopi or Nanti Kita Cerita Tentang Hari Ini (NKCTHI).

These films are slick, visually stunning, and marketed toward the urban youth. They tackle themes of mental health, ambition, and generational trauma. While some critics argue they are too polished or "style over substance," their impact is undeniable. They bridged the gap between the indie crowd and the general public. They made it cool to watch Indonesian films again.

Take NKCTHI, for instance. It transformed a story about a dysfunctional family into a viral phenomenon, proving that local dramas could be event viewing. This genre has become the face of modern "Fmzm" (Formidable) Indonesian cinema—relatable, emotional, and undeniably polished.

The Evolution of Modern Indonesian Cinema

Indonesian cinema has moved far beyond the low-budget horror tropes of the early 2000s. Today, the industry is defined by diverse storytelling, high production values, and a new generation of visionary directors.

Action Excellence: Films like The Raid put Indonesia on the map for martial arts choreography (Pencak Silat).

Art-House Success: Directors like Kamila Andini and Edwin have won prestigious awards at Berlin and Locarno. Fmzm Film Indonesia

Commercial Powerhouses: Local blockbusters like KKN di Desa Penari have proven that domestic films can outearn Hollywood imports at the local box office. Top Genres to Explore in Indonesian Film

Indonesian horror is unique because it draws from deep-rooted local superstitions and diverse cultural myths.

Key Titles: Pengabdi Setan (Satan's Slaves), Perempuan Tanah Jahanam (Impetigore).

Why it works: It combines atmospheric dread with social commentary. 2. Heart-Wrenching Dramas

Indonesians are masters of the "tear-jerker." These films often focus on family dynamics, religious devotion, or star-crossed lovers.

Key Titles: Nanti Kita Cerita Tentang Hari Ini, Sayap-Sayap Patah. 3. Action and Crime Thrillers

With gritty realism and intense stunt work, Indonesian action films are now a benchmark for the genre globally. Key Titles: The Big 4, The Night Comes for Us. Leading Figures in the Industry

Joko Anwar: The king of modern Indonesian horror and elevated thrillers.

Timo Tjahjanto: Known for extreme action and "splatter" horror.

Mira Lesmana: A legendary producer who revitalized the industry with cult classics like Ada Apa Dengan Cinta?.

Reza Rahadian: Often cited as the most versatile actor in the country, appearing in everything from biopics to comedies. Why the Interest in "Fmzm Film Indonesia"?
